Title: Richard J Robbins: A Pioneer in Utility Vehicle and Fishing Reel Innovations
Introduction
Richard J Robbins, an influential inventor based in Derby, Kansas, has made significant contributions to the fields of utility vehicles and fishing gear. With an impressive portfolio of 74 patents, Robbins has demonstrated his innovative spirit and ability to create practical solutions for various outdoor activities. His work has greatly impacted the way people enjoy recreational pursuits.
Latest Patents
Among Richard J Robbins' latest patents are groundbreaking inventions such as the All-Terrain Utility Vehicle and a Bait Casting Fishing Reel. These inventions showcase his ability to merge functionality with user experience, providing outdoor enthusiasts with reliable and efficient equipment.
Career Highlights
Robbins has had a notable career, working at prominent companies like Zebco Corporation and Brunswick Corporation. His tenure at these organizations helped shape his innovative ideas and paved the way for his successful patent filings.
Collaborations
Throughout his career, Robbins has collaborated with talented individuals such as Robert W Fee and Hyunkyu Kim. These partnerships have fostered creativity and led to the development of remarkable inventions that have made a lasting impact on their respective industries.
